The forty-sixth Annual Association Tournament for the Meridian Women's Bowling Association is scheduled for March 25-26 and April 1-2. All entries should be turned into tournament directors Mary Formby or Betty Aycock on or before March 12. The forty-ninth Association Tournament for the Meridian Men's Bowling Association will start in just a few weeks. March 4-5 and 11-12 with reserved entries closing on February 17. Please have your entries returned to Jason Pierce, Gene Derusha or Kenneth Miller.
